发明名称 System and method for managing construction projects
摘要 A system for managing construction projects includes a database, a component interface, a state interface, and a database interface. The component interface is operative to receive component identifiers identifying components of a construction project. The state interface is operative to receive state indicators, each state indicator indicating a particular state (e.g., ordered, in transit, installed, inspected, etc.) associated with one of the components. The database interface is operative to store the component identifiers and the associated state indicators in the database. A method of managing construction projects is also described. The method includes the steps of receiving a plurality of component identifiers from a user, associating an initial predefined state with each received identifier, storing the component identifiers and the associated initial states in a database, updating the states associated with the component identifiers in the data base, and retrieving the updated states from the database to determine the status of the construction project. Novel data structures, application program interfaces, and graphical user interfaces are also disclosed.
申请公布号 US8782093(B2) 申请公布日期 2014.07.15
申请号 US200812221621 申请日期 2008.08.05
申请人 GCC, Inc. 发明人 Greer Gary L.;Hohn John T.;Flores Margaret L.
分类号 G06F17/30 主分类号 G06F17/30
代理机构 Henneman & Associates, PLC 代理人 Henneman, Jr. Larry E.;Gibson Gregory P.;Henneman & Associates, PLC
主权项 1. In a computer system, a method for managing a construction project, executed by a least one or more processors, said method comprising: receiving a plurality of identifiers from a user, each of said identifiers identifying a respective component of said construction project; associating an initial one of at least three predefined states with each of said identifiers, said predefined states indicating the construction status of the component identified by the associated identifier; writing records to a database, said records including said identifiers and said associated initial states; updating the states associated with said identifiers by writing records to said database associating different ones of said predefined states with said identifiers; and retrieving the updated states from said database to determine the status of said construction project; and wherein said step of updating said states associated with said identifiers depends on changes in the construction status of said components identified by said identifiers; and said step of updating said states includes retrieving said identifiers from said database,retrieving said predefined states from said database,presenting said identifiers and said predefined states to said user,receiving a selection of one of said identifiers to be updated from a list of identifiers from said user,receiving a selection of a state from a list of predefined states from said user, andwriting a record to said database associating said selected identifier with said selected state.
地址 San Jose CA US